      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;STRONG&gt;Content originally posted in LPCWare by R2D2 on Fri Jul 10 07:07:19 MST 2015&lt;/STRONG&gt;&lt;BR /&gt;&lt;HR /&gt;&lt;SPAN style="color: #0000ff;"&gt;&lt;STRONG&gt;Quote: Bela&lt;/STRONG&gt;&lt;BR /&gt;...how to stop the timer.&lt;/SPAN&gt;&lt;HR /&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;Clearing bit 0 of TCR is stopping the timer&amp;nbsp; &lt;SPAN class="lia-unicode-emoji" title=":face_with_open_mouth:"&gt;&lt;LI-EMOJI id="lia_face-with-open-mouth" title=":face_with_open_mouth:"&gt;&lt;/LI-EMOJI&gt;&lt;/SPAN&gt; &l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;HR /&gt;&lt;SPAN style="color: #0000ff;"&gt;&lt;STRONG&gt;Quote: Bela&lt;/STRONG&gt;&lt;BR /&gt;Where can I read more about these possibilities? Excuse me, I don't clearly understand what EMR is...&lt;/SPAN&gt;&lt;HR /&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;UM10360:&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;HR /&gt;&lt;SPAN style="color: #0000ff;"&gt;&lt;STRONG&gt;Quote: &lt;/STRONG&gt;&lt;BR /&gt;21.5 Pin description&lt;BR /&gt;...&lt;BR /&gt;Output External Match Output - When a match register (MR3:0) equals the timer counter (TC) this output can either toggle, go low, go high, or do nothing. The External Match Register (EMR) controls the functionality of this output. Match Output functionality can be selected on a number of pins in parallel. So you can use EMR to switch MAT pins, if they are selected.&lt;BR /&gt;&lt;/SPAN&gt;&lt;HR /&gt;&lt;BR /&gt;&lt;SPAN&gt;In your case:&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;TABLE border="1"&gt;&lt;TBODY&gt;&lt;TR&gt;&lt;TD bgcolor="#cacaca"&gt; &lt;PRE&gt;void EMR_init(void)
{
 LPC_IOCON-&amp;gt;PINSEL[3] |= (3&amp;lt;&amp;lt;24) | (3&amp;lt;&amp;lt;26);//select MAT0.0 (P1[28]) / MAT0.1 (P1[29])
 LPC_TIMER0-&amp;gt;EMR = (3&amp;lt;&amp;lt;4)|(3&amp;lt;&amp;lt;6); //set match function 1:clear 2:set 3:toggle
}
&lt;/PRE&gt; &lt;/TD&gt;&lt;/TR&gt;&lt;/TBODY&gt;&lt;/TABLE&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;Now MAT0.0 / MAT0.1 pins are toggled&amp;nbsp; &lt;SPAN class="lia-unicode-emoji" title=":slightly_smiling_face:"&gt;&lt;LI-EMOJI id="lia_slightly-smiling-face" title=":slightly_smiling_face:"&gt;&lt;/LI-EMOJI&gt;&lt;/SPAN&gt; &l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;Of course you can also switch this pins with setting / clearing EM bit:&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;HR /&gt;&lt;SPAN style="color: #0000ff;"&gt;&lt;STRONG&gt;Quote: &lt;/STRONG&gt;&lt;BR /&gt;EM0 External Match 0. &lt;BR /&gt;When a match occurs between the TC and MR0, this bit can either toggle, go low, go high, or do nothing, depending on bits 5:4 of this register. This bit can be driven onto a MATn.0 pin, in a positive-logic manner (0 = low, 1 = high).&lt;BR /&gt;&lt;/SPAN&gt;&lt;HR /&gt;&lt;BR /&gt;&lt;SPAN&gt;In your case:&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;TABLE border="1"&gt;&lt;TBODY&gt;&lt;TR&gt;&lt;TD bgcolor="#cacaca"&gt; &lt;PRE&gt;LPC_TIMER0-&amp;gt;EMR |= (1&amp;lt;&amp;lt;0);//set MAT0.0&lt;/PRE&gt; &lt;/TD&gt;&lt;/TR&gt;&lt;/TBODY&gt;&lt;/TABLE&gt;&lt;BR /&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>

      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;STRONG&gt;Content originally posted in LPCWare by R2D2 on Fri Jul 10 08:51:49 MST 2015&lt;/STRONG&gt;&lt;BR /&gt;&lt;SPAN&gt;An easy way to check IR is to set the breakpoint in a stop / start sequence:&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;TABLE border="1"&gt;&lt;TBODY&gt;&lt;TR&gt;&lt;TD bgcolor="#cacaca"&gt; &lt;PRE&gt;void TIMER0_IRQHandler (void)
{
 NVIC_ClearPendingIRQ(TIMER0_IRQn);
 if(LPC_TIMER0-&amp;gt;IR &amp;amp; (1&amp;lt;&amp;lt;0))// if Timer0 Match0 resulted an IT
 {
&amp;nbsp; LPC_TIMER0-&amp;gt;TCR&amp;amp;= ~(1&amp;lt;&amp;lt;0);// stop timer
[color=#f00](insert breakpoint here)[/color]&amp;nbsp; LPC_TIMER0-&amp;gt;IR = (1&amp;lt;&amp;lt;0);// clear IT request
&amp;nbsp; LPC_TIMER0-&amp;gt;TCR|= (1&amp;lt;&amp;lt;0);// start timer
&amp;nbsp; Timer0Match0IT();// then call Timer0Match0IT
 }
 if(LPC_TIMER0-&amp;gt;IR &amp;amp; (1&amp;lt;&amp;lt;1))// if Timer0 Match1 resulted an IT
 {
&amp;nbsp; LPC_TIMER0-&amp;gt;TCR&amp;amp;= ~(1&amp;lt;&amp;lt;0);// stop timer
[color=#f00](insert breakpoint here)[/color]&amp;nbsp; LPC_TIMER0-&amp;gt;IR = (1&amp;lt;&amp;lt;1);// clear IT request
&amp;nbsp; LPC_TIMER0-&amp;gt;TCR|= (1&amp;lt;&amp;lt;0);// start timer
&amp;nbsp; Timer0Match1IT();// then call Timer0Match1IT service routine
 }
}
&lt;/PRE&gt; &lt;/TD&gt;&lt;/TR&gt;&lt;/TBODY&gt;&lt;/TABLE&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>
